In music, an octave refers to a musical interval between two notes that have a frequency ratio of 2:1. This means that the higher note is double the frequency of the lower note, creating a sense of similarity and harmony between the two notes.
The frequency of a 440 Hz note in music is the pitch commonly used as the reference point for tuning instruments. It is known as the standard tuning pitch, meaning that most instruments are tuned so that the A above middle C corresponds to a frequency of 440 Hz.

The frequency of vibrations in music is measured in Hertz (Hz). This unit represents the number of vibrations per second. In music, different pitches are created by varying the frequency of vibrations produced by the sound waves.
